Custom items are a feature that allows you to save multiple pieces of furniture and decorations as one set for reuse.

Overview

ItemDescription
DefinitionMultiple items (normal items) saved as one asset while preserving their positional relationships and material information.
Use CasesSaving dining sets, pre-decorated shelves, etc.
Save LocationSaved to the user’s “My Catalog.”

Operations

Creation (Save) Procedure

  1. Select multiple items on the scene that will be included.
  2. Open the “World Outliner” panel.
  3. Enter a name and click “Save Custom Item to My Catalog.”
  4. Adjust the camera in the thumbnail capture screen and confirm.

Placement Procedure

  1. Open the “My Catalog” tab in the catalog.
  2. Drag and drop the created item to place it.

Release (Disassemble) Procedure

If you want to edit a placed custom item individually, disassemble it with the following steps:

  1. Select the placed custom item.
  2. Click the “Ungroup (Release)” button in the toolbar.

⚠️

Limitations:

  • As of August 2025, items imported from external sources (FBX/OBJ, etc.) cannot be included in custom items.
  • Once released, the link as the original “custom item” is lost (it becomes just a collection of furniture).

Differences from Normal Items

ItemNormal ItemsCustom Items
CompositionSingle productSet of multiple items
Position InfoNonePreserves relative positions between items
MaterialsIndividual settingsPreserves settings from save time
EditingDirect editingEdit after Ungroup
